**Handover — Pilot Churn (for the board)**

Sorrel, here's where things stand as I pass the Bramblewick pilot to you. Churn in the trial cohort hit 14% last month — mostly small accounts who never finished onboarding. The bigger shops are sticking, which is the good news. I've flagged the onboarding flow for a rebuild and asked Priya's team to call every lapsed account this fortnight. Board wants a steadier number before we expand. The strategic reasoning is captured in the note below.

internal memo for bahap-yagug: Headcount on the Ulaix team goes from 3 to 100 by the end of January. Gross margin on Ulaix came in at 10 percent against a plan of 15 percent.

- [ ] **Step 7: Breaker override escrow.** After sealing the signing keys for the Tallgrove upstream API circuit breaker, confirm the support team can force the breaker open during a full outage. The override bundle lives in the sealed escrow drawer and is useless without its unlock phrase. Two ceremony witnesses must initial this step before proceeding. The escrow bundle is decrypted with the recovery passphrase that follows.

vault phrase of kahip-kahop = holath-quenmir

## Deployment

Canary rollouts on Lanternfield gate automatically: traffic ramps only if error rate, latency p99, and saturation all stay within bounds for two consecutive windows. A single breach halts the ramp; two breaches roll back without paging you. If you need to override, read the gating values first. The current gating configuration is listed below.

deployment values, yadug-bawif:
[framir]
team = pelox
access_code = ac_a38ab2
owner = tamion.julael
host = framir.tolvaqlabs.test
port = 11211
peer = tammir.zemvargrid.local
salt = 2215ef03
pin = 1541

Subject: Key rotation — build agent clock skew fallout

Hey all,

Quick heads-up: we traced last week's intermittent signing failures to clock skew between the Pavilion build agents — some drifted almost four minutes, which made short-lived tokens expire before use. NTP is fixed, but out of caution we're rotating the Forgeline artifact-service key today. Old key dies Friday noon. Update your agent configs before then and ping the platform channel if anything breaks. New key for the staging tier follows.

app token of bahaf-tajeg = zpat23_SjjsllwiLmXbtS65veZaV47